Understanding Sexual Assault Charges in Garrett County
Maryland law defines sexual assault under Md. Code, Criminal Law Article, covering offenses from second-degree assault to first-degree rape. In Garrett County, these charges are prosecuted by the State’s Attorney for Garrett County. A conviction can result in mandatory sex offender registration, significant prison time, and fines. The specific statute governing these offenses is Md. Code, Criminal Law Article § 3-307 (sexual assault in the first degree) and related sections.

Insider Procedural Edge: What to Expect in Garrett County
Garrett County District Court handles initial appearances for all sexual assault cases. Felony charges proceed to Garrett County Circuit Court for jury trials. The State’s Attorney for Garrett County prosecutes these cases aggressively.

What is Probation Before Judgment (PBJ) for sexual assault in Garrett County?
Yes, PBJ is available for some sexual offenses in Maryland. PBJ places you on probation without entering a guilty verdict, avoiding a formal conviction. After completing probation, PBJ cases can be expunged after a 3-year waiting period. A Sexual Assault Lawyer Garrett County can evaluate eligibility.
Can I get my sexual assault record expunged in Garrett County?
It depends. Maryland allows expungement for acquittals, dismissals, Nolle Prosequi, Stet, and PBJ (after 3 years). Some non-violent convictions may qualify under the Justice Reinvestment Act. Cases in Garrett County are expunged through the court where the case was heard.
What happens after a sexual assault arrest in Garrett County?
After arrest: (1) initial appearance before a District Court commissioner who sets bail, (2) bail review hearing within 24 hours if detained, (3) preliminary hearing within 30 days, (4) grand jury indictment for felonies, (5) trial in Circuit Court.
